Definition
They agreed to disagree: They maintained opposing points of view and didn't discuss it further, They kept their opinions and stopped arguing about it

1 agree: "To agree to (have a meeting)" is to consent to or accept it. The idiom "(let's) agree to disagree" is often used to acknowledge that further debate is futile or pointless because neither party is willing to concede a point or change their opinion. Enriqué uses this expression because he realizes that further argument with Brent about soccer is unnecessary or pointless. Note that "to agree" does not take an auxiliary verb.
2 disagree: This is correct. To "disagree (to a meeting)" is to "refuse" or "decline" it. The idiom "(let's) agree to disagree" refers to situation where two or more people resolve a dispute by tolerating (but not accepting) the other's views. Enriqué uses this expression because he realizes that further argument is unnecessary. Note that "to disagree" does not take an auxiliary verb.
